David Jamieson - Founder, Salus Technical

David Jamieson has over a decade of experience in the engineering industry - half of which spent running his own business, Salus Technical. We spoke to David about his experience on Cohort 4 of our Grey Matters programme and how it helped him to develop his business.

 How did you find out about Grey Matters?

“It was flagged to me by my dedicated business adviser, who I was working with to help develop my business.”

 What were your aims/goals when joining the programme? 

“I had a passion for my craft and an idea that I was excited about. My knowledge of building a business came only from my own research and the books I had read.

“Being able to hear from experts and work together with others in a similar position was something I was really looking forward to. I wanted to make the most of this wonderful opportunity.”

Did you have any preconceived ideas of what to expect?

“I remember being hugely excited the night before our first session and it didn’t disappoint. My first day was spent with Dr. John Park, and from here on I knew it was going to be a brilliant and informative programme.”

What was your experience – on the whole, like?

“Overall, I loved the programme. Some of the sessions were built on what I already knew but many were completely new and required a large step outside of my comfort zone.

“As time went on, I could feel my creative side building as lots of new ideas kept coming to me. Although we unfortunately didn’t end up taking the business forward together, I loved working with others in my group, especially on our pitches. It made me further recognise the value in diverse thinking and power in not working alone.”  

 Do you feel the programme has been a platform for helping develop you/your business further? 

“100%. It has made me view a lot of the steps in building a business differently – and in a good way.

“I feel a lot more resilient and now look at things through a different lens. I have a far greater understanding of the support that is out there.”

 Where is your business now? 

“Our first software product is currently being tested by some prospective customers with a view towards a wider launch later in the year.”

 Anything else you’d like to add?

“I feel part of the Elevator community now. The other businesses to come out of our Cohort are in regular contact and always helping each other out.

“Programme Leaders John and Karen go to impressive lengths to ensure that we have the best speakers as well as panels for our pitches. Businesses from previous cohorts and the Oil and Gas Technology Centre’s programme, TechX, gave up so much of their time to listen, share their experiences, listen to our pitches and help us with Business Model Canvases.”
